🇪🇪

Üllar

9.1

August 2024

A complex located on a rather large area, which is part of a former 14th (probably) century castle. It is not as grand and ostentatious as the villas built at the turn of the last century, but the entire complex has been tastefully renovated and both buildings and gardens are well maintained. Often hotels in old villas are quite run down and this hotel was a pleasant exception and everything here is in good condition. NB! The owners also live in the same territory. Our room (408) was quite ascetic. Judging by the pictures, many of the rooms are much nicer and better decorated. There was also a possibility to make coffee in the room. The pool is not very big, but big enough to swim a little. The pool area looks good and is nicely designed, there is also a separate pool bar. Check-out is at 11:00, but you are allowed to stay a little longer if you want to spend time by the pool. There is a separate shower room and a place where you can change clothes. About 15 minutes drive from the highway. The famous The Mall outlet is also about 15 minutes drive away. The breakfast was good, according to the Italian custom, the selection of sweet cakes was particularly large, but luckily the selection of savory food was also sufficient. The dinner was good, but based on the previous rave reviews, I expected more.

There was no big mirror in the room, the only mirror was in the bathroom above the sink. There were no toothbrush holders in the bathroom. There is no sunshade by the pool, but there are a few trees where you can go under the shade. There were also horseflies by the pool, but fortunately not many, and unfortunately you can't get away from them in the countryside. There may be a shortage of sunbeds during peak hours. From the reception and the parking lot to the rooms it is quite a long cobbled road and the wheels of the suitcase do not move on such a road, but the reception will take you there with a golf cart if necessary.
